Activity Sharing and wheelchair algorithms make watchOS 3 even better for the fitness fiends

With the Activity app being one of the most popular Apple Watch apps, Apple has announced a new way to compete with your friends. Activity Sharing will allow you to easily compete with your friends, talk smack to them and more right from your wrist. That's right, you can now swipe right from the Activity screen to see what your friends are up to. You can sort by steps, workouts or whatever else may be important to you.

To communicate with your friends, you'll be able to send messages from a list of Smart Replies, send heart rate, audio messages or scribble to them. After working with medical experts, Apple was able to build a special algorithm for wheelchair users. That's right, those in a wheelchair will see "Time to Roll" instead of "Time to Stand," as well as optimized workout and activity rings.
